Erro de cor para discourse_publish_format_html

Recentemente, executei vários testes que envolviam clicar no botão Atualizar Tópico enquanto fazia alterações no snippet discourse_publish.

Cada vez que eu via a mensagem verde: O tópico do Discourse foi atualizado!

Com o tempo, eu só procurava pela cor verde, até que finalmente percebi que a mensagem de erro também tem um fundo verde.

Se possível, seria bom dar às mensagens de erro um fundo vermelho.

Desculpe, você pode fornecer uma captura de tela? Não estou entendendo.

Da tela de edição de post do WP:


O plano de fundo desta mensagem é verde, mas quando há uma mensagem de erro, ela também é exibida com um fundo verde.

Acho que seria preferível que os fundos das mensagens de erro tivessem uma cor diferente, talvez vermelho claro, para destacar o fato de que algo está errado.

Acabei de receber outra mensagem de erro do Plugin do WP, e desta vez ela estava com fundo vermelho. Então, ou isso já foi corrigido, ou nem todas as mensagens de erro são iguais, ou eu tive algum problema de cache.

Oi @RichardC, você poderia compartilhar qual erro específico você viu com fundo verde?

@angus Eu realmente gostaria de poder, mas corrigi o erro o mais rápido possível e não sei como recriá-lo. Vou ficar de olho e pegá-lo se eu o vir novamente.

Finalmente peguei um erro em verde

Se você quiser duplicar esse erro, é isso que estou tentando fazer:

		if ( has_post_thumbnail( $post_id ) ) {
			$image = get_the_post_thumbnail( $post->ID, 'medium' );
		} else {
			$image = "";
		} ?>

EDIT: O erro era o ?> no final do código acima

Obrigado pelo retorno! Para esclarecer, você está dizendo que:

  1. é possível gerar uma cor de erro incorreta;

  2. ao usar o filtro discourse_publish_format_html;

  3. em certas circunstâncias. Nessas circunstâncias, qual das opções abaixo é verdadeira:

    • você sempre vê o erro em verde ao usar o filtro; ou
    • você sempre vê o erro em verde ao usar o filtro com o trecho acima; ou
    • você às vezes vê o erro em verde ao usar o filtro com o trecho acima

Além disso, como você parece ter outras personalizações (por exemplo, o elemento 15 / 100), estamos apenas verificando se há algum erro de JavaScript no console da web quando a cor incorreta aparece?

Esse. A pontuação 15/100 é uma pontuação de SEO fictícia que não deve afetar nada mais.

Portanto, se o filtro estiver escrito incorretamente (ou seja, com um ?> extra que não deveria estar lá), a mensagem de erro é exibida de forma inadequada.

Atenciosamente, Richard